Transaction 8872ec42a7910507efdea145516100f2dcb90371bc0a79c83a8b9aaa1ad0f99d
1 Input
1 Output
-
8872ec42a7910507efdea145516100f2dcb90371bc0a79c83a8b9aaa1ad0f99d:0
- value
- 22432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c80ce1cfba1a9bb97372092b9878fe9eb2140b5 OP_EQUAL
- address
- 3FxXe1LVKRNEAbcUzQdVpVoVXwnaoM2EoH